![]() Bandon Oregon is gaining international notoriety for world-class golf courses. This qaint, coastside town in southern Oregon offers other activities to dovetail with golf while out on vacation. Other popular activites nearby include beachcombing, horseback riding, wind surfing, agate collecting, crabbing and clamming,and of course, guided fishing. The Coquille River enters the Pacific Ocean at Bandon. Other wonderful opportunites for salmon and steelead fishing are available all within an hours drive of Bandon. The mouth of the Rogue River, the Elk and Sixes Rivers, and Coos Bay at Charelston all produce salmon. Late summer through late fall is primetime. |
